about anna
Born in Atlanta, Georgia, Anna moved to Toronto, Ontario with her family when she was six. Anna has fond memories of yearly trips from Toronto to New York State, Pennsylvania and Ohio to visit her grandparents, aunts and uncles, traveling through Niagara's fruit belt and the orchards bordering the route. The family would regularly make stops at farmer's fruit stands to pick up fresh goodies for the relatives.
Anna's family is of Eastern European heritage and baking and cooking has always been at the heart of every family gathering. It is within these family occasions, respecting tradition, that Anna first gained a love and appreciation for both baking and cooking. These childhood memories and experiences invoke the inspirations we see today in so many of her recipes.
Anna took her love of cooking from personal passion to professional career when, after achieving a degree in Political Studies from Queen’s University and a brief stint working in the banking world, she enrolled in the culinary management program at Johnson & Wales University in Vail, Colorado. Her work adventures ultimately led her to the Niagara region in 1995, where she has been happily settled ever since.
Anna comes by her creativity honestly; her Dad is a graphic artist who taught for many years at York University in Toronto. Using food as her creative medium, Anna starts with ingredients that "sound good" or "delicious", then works her way back, creating the components within the recipe body to get to the yummy end result. Recipe development is one of her great accomplishments, with six successful cookbook publications to her name and “Back to Baking” , released in Autumn 2011. Entering a new realm of media, Anna & Michael have launched the “Olson Recipe Maker” app for iPhone, iPad and Android in fall 2011.
